The Production brings the focus back to the show’s origins as a rock concept album, emphasizing a rock concert aesthetic rather than musical theater.

Specifically looking for exceptional singer/dancers who have an authentic feel, understanding & passion for the sound & music of late 60s/early 70s rock music. In particular The Beatles, Gloria Jones, Led Zeppelin, Stevie Wonder, Carol King, James Taylor, Joni Mitchell & Pink Floyd. Music choices should evoke this.

SINGERS:

Seeking Singer/ Dancers of ALL Gender Identities – versatile, strong classic rock, pop or soul singers who are also outstanding dancers. Must be both excellent dancers and singers. Character ages are 20's/30's. Performers of all ethnic and racial backgrounds are encouraged to apply. The choreography is extremely rhythmic, energetic and requires physical stamina. Ensemble members must be comfortable being able to sing well and engage in intense aerobic movement at the same time. Portions of the show involve lifts and partnering, jumping and kneeling. A dance background in any of the following styles is helpful: modern, contemporary, jazz, hip-hop, African, musical theater. Men appear shirtless at times and some women appear with bare midriffs.

Featured roles such as HEROD, SIMON and PETER will come out of the ensemble. Members of the Ensemble may also cover select principal roles. All ensemble members will need to dance or move extremely well.

[HEROD] High baritone; 30 -50s (B3 – G5) Featured ensemble role. The former Superstar, now gone to seed. Cynical, comedic, cruel: a creature. Candidates are encouraged to bring in their own individual performance. Director will shape concept around the right artist.

[SIMON] 20s- 40s. Tenor/high baritone (D3-Bb4(+)) with authentic northern soul/church/RnB voice to escalate the 1st act into a musical frenzy. Featured Ensemble role. Fanatic follower of Jesus and his underground movement. Instigator, outlaw, protestor.

[PETER] Folk-rock baritone, 20s- 30s. (D3-G4) Featured Ensemble role. Heartbreaking voice with a little edge. James Taylor/Rod Stewart. Guitar skills essential. Mild-mannered follower, scared believer.
